Description
John has been an investigator and investigation manager at HMRC and the FCA for 28 years. During this time, he has managed some of the highest profile domestic and international fraud cases seen in the courts. In his current role he manages a large FCA enforcement team focussing on wide ranging financial crime cases, prior to which he was the FCA’s designated technical specialist for dishonesty in authorised firms and Cryptoasset investigations.
